Output d26c0a55616f46a068197d6df964394358f8ac533539984e9a8212ea97a57c77:7

value
1037291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57458eb40fc94bb8a387eded89eb0138a4574a0 OP_EQUAL
address
3Q4rrVnTmwSBw5DZqAgtG1DGzgraSy7FRd
transaction
d26c0a55616f46a068197d6df964394358f8ac533539984e9a8212ea97a57c77
spent
true